Mercurial > public > mercurial-scm > python-hglib
comparison tests/test_branch.py @ 221:a2afbf236ca8
hglib tests: remove deprecated constructions
This mostly removes usage of 'assertEquals' (replaced with 'assertEqual'),
as well as opening files without closing them
(fixed using a 'with' statement).
author | Mathias De Mare <mathias.de_mare@nokia.com> |
---|---|
date | Thu, 09 Mar 2023 14:00:02 +0100 |
parents | 8341f2494b3f |
children |
comparison
equal
deleted
inserted
replaced
220:ae6427d1c8f7 | 221:a2afbf236ca8 |
---|---|
2 import hglib | 2 import hglib |
3 from hglib.util import b | 3 from hglib.util import b |
4 | 4 |
5 class test_branch(common.basetest): | 5 class test_branch(common.basetest): |
6 def test_empty(self): | 6 def test_empty(self): |
7 self.assertEquals(self.client.branch(), b('default')) | 7 self.assertEqual(self.client.branch(), b('default')) |
8 | 8 |
9 def test_basic(self): | 9 def test_basic(self): |
10 self.assertEquals(self.client.branch(b('foo')), b('foo')) | 10 self.assertEqual(self.client.branch(b('foo')), b('foo')) |
11 self.append('a', 'a') | 11 self.append('a', 'a') |
12 rev, node = self.client.commit(b('first'), addremove=True) | 12 rev, node = self.client.commit(b('first'), addremove=True) |
13 | 13 |
14 rev = self.client.log(node)[0] | 14 rev = self.client.log(node)[0] |
15 | 15 |
16 self.assertEquals(rev.branch, b('foo')) | 16 self.assertEqual(rev.branch, b('foo')) |
17 self.assertEquals(self.client.branches(), | 17 self.assertEqual(self.client.branches(), |
18 [(rev.branch, int(rev.rev), rev.node[:12])]) | 18 [(rev.branch, int(rev.rev), rev.node[:12])]) |
19 | 19 |
20 def test_reset_with_name(self): | 20 def test_reset_with_name(self): |
21 self.assertRaises(ValueError, self.client.branch, b('foo'), clean=True) | 21 self.assertRaises(ValueError, self.client.branch, b('foo'), clean=True) |
22 | 22 |
23 def test_reset(self): | 23 def test_reset(self): |
24 self.client.branch(b('foo')) | 24 self.client.branch(b('foo')) |
25 self.assertEquals(self.client.branch(clean=True), b('default')) | 25 self.assertEqual(self.client.branch(clean=True), b('default')) |
26 | 26 |
27 def test_exists(self): | 27 def test_exists(self): |
28 self.append('a', 'a') | 28 self.append('a', 'a') |
29 self.client.commit(b('first'), addremove=True) | 29 self.client.commit(b('first'), addremove=True) |
30 self.client.branch(b('foo')) | 30 self.client.branch(b('foo')) |
40 self.append('a', 'a') | 40 self.append('a', 'a') |
41 self.client.commit(b('second')) | 41 self.client.commit(b('second')) |
42 | 42 |
43 self.assertRaises(hglib.error.CommandError, | 43 self.assertRaises(hglib.error.CommandError, |
44 self.client.branch, b('default')) | 44 self.client.branch, b('default')) |
45 self.assertEquals(self.client.branch(b('default'), force=True), | 45 self.assertEqual(self.client.branch(b('default'), force=True), |
46 b('default')) | 46 b('default')) |